Solar panel power generation energy meter

Solar panel power generation energy meter

A generation meter helps solar panel owners by showing how much energy their system produces. It records the energy output in real-time, making it easier to track performance. Owners can see if their panels work well or need maintenance. There are different types of solar panel meters, but they all provide similar. . How many watts does a solar panel in a residential building have

How many watts does a solar panel in a residential building have

The solar panel wattage is also known as the power rating, and it's a panel's electrical output under ideal conditions. A panel will usually produce between 250 and 400 watts of power. For the equation later on, assume an average of 320 W per panel. Once you know how many solar panels you need, you're one step closer to finding out how much solar costs. . Most residential solar panels fall into the 250W to 450W range, depending on the technology and manufacturer. But though commercial systems may use panels exceeding 500W.
